ABOUT

Established in 1997 by community members of the Ripon Area School District, the Ripon Education Foundation serves as the non-profit fundraising organization for the Ripon Area School District. Gifts to the Foundation benefit and support Ripon Area School District students, teachers, and initiatives. The Ripon Education Foundation is an independent charitable organization and makes its own decisions based on its goals and bylaws. The Foundation is led by a volunteer Board of Directors. In accordance with the Foundation’s bylaws, the Board of Education has one non-voting representative. Additionally, the District’s superintendent of schools is a non-voting member and serves as board secretary.

our MISSION

To enrich learning for Ripon students, encourage excellence and innovation in learning, support postsecondary opportunities for graduates and strengthen the ties between the Ripon community and the Ripon Area School District.

Our Board of Directors

The Ripon Education Foundation Board of Directors consists of volunteer citizens of the Ripon area. Each member serves a three-year term and donates his/her time and energy to strengthen teaching and learning within the Ripon School District. The Board of Directors meets monthly.
